At the end of March 2012, the ILRI Board of Trustees reviewed and discussed the annotated outline of a new strategy document to cover the years 2013-2022.
The document introduces ILRI ‘today’. It sets out critical livestock sector development challenges for ILRI and the principles guiding our approach.
It then turns to the research agenda, outlining areas of research focus (such as: biosciences for animal health, genetics, feeding; Market based livestock development; Systems research spanning mixed crop livestock and pastoral systems, modeling and assessment of trade offs; Livestock-environment; Livestock – human health and nutrition; and Livestock productivity) as well as the pathways ILRI could use to generate outputs, outcomes and development impacts (such as: attention to gender; Innovation research; Partnerships; Capacity development; and Communication and knowledge management).
